I planning to make old classics like whack-a-mole, a combination guessing game and some aiming based ones.
With time and resources something close to a boardgame with dice rolls and events could be on the list.
(all the above would be supported by normal redstone, no mods required)

While game using mods/editors are fun and easier to get (install, paste the circuit, done) they are quite server intensive and of course they require to be installed on the server itself.

I've seen games of tag, gree light red light and such and they can be good, but they involve extensive use of command blocks and wouldn't really work with more than a few players at once.

Even if they added those in the event server, you'd need to take turns to play unlike the old Cube event where you "just" need to have no lag.

No redstone was used in this game. We are building it from carpets and wool purely. The board will be set up and rule boards will be set up next to it, as well as a chest on each side for conquered pieces and a chest for pieces that are king (solid wool blocks).
